Originally Posted by cyberkarl
I had recently booked LH roundtrip from the US to Italy, through MUC. LH canceled the return flight. They are offering a refund, minus a $20 service fee for the tickets. I had six tickets, so this is $120. Customer service refused to refund the service fee. I have now complained to U.S. DoT and LH's online customer service team. Seems odd that the airline gets to keep my even some of money when they are the ones who canceled the flight, regardless of what their contract says. Why not charge a $500 service fee instead and make it more profitable? Anyone have experience getting this refunded?
You should have hung up, call again and spoke with another agent.
Nobody has charged me anything when I cancelled LH tickets for a full refund during irregular operations, cancellations and schedule changes.

Of course if you have booked with a travel agent and called Lufthansa, they might be able to charge a fee for that.
